New Hartford Tops Clinton Again In Boys Soccer

New Hartford, NY (WKTV) - The New Hartford Spartans beat Clinton 2-0 in boys soccer on Tuesday. AJ Wolfanger broke a scoreless tie with just over 20 minutes to go in the second half. Nate Mansur added an insurance goal with under two minutes to play. Tom Gilroy stopped eight shots to earn the shutout. Rob Larkin had seven saves for Clinton who drops to 10-3-1. New Hartford is now 8-5-1.
